Ferrari will be a different team in 2015 - Mattiacci

Marco Mattiacci is undertaking a restructuring process at Ferrari Sutton Images Enlarge Ferrari team principal Marco Mattiacci says he is "preparing a different team for 2015" but declined to go into details. Ahead of the British Grand Prix Corriere dello Sport reported that engine boss Luca Marmorini, who oversaw the design of the team's underpowered V6 power unit, had left the team. But Mattiacci, who replaced Stefano Domenicali as team boss in April, said he would not be disclosing any of his plans for the future any time soon. "I don't have to make any announcements," he said.
